Anatomy and Design Features The design of these instruments varies significantly to accommodate different surgical specialties and hand sizes. Standard models typically feature a ratcheted locking mechanism near the finger rings, which allows the surgeon to lock the jaws onto the needle. This locking feature reduces hand fatigue during long procedures because the surgeon does not need to maintain constant pressure to keep the jaws closed. The jaws themselves are often reinforced with tungsten carbide inserts, which are harder than stainless steel and provide a durable, non-slip surface. This specific design element ensures that the needle holder maintains its grip over thousands of sterilization cycles.
Selecting the Right Instrument for the Procedure Choosing the correct size and style of instrument is paramount for efficient surgery. A delicate microsurgery procedure requires a different tool than a heavy orthopedic repair. For instance, instruments designed for plastic surgery have fine tips and smooth jaws to handle tiny needles and very fine suture material, preventing damage to the delicate thread. Conversely, a general surgery instrument will have sturdier jaws with serrations to grip larger needles securely. Surgeons must match the instrument to the needle size, as using a large needle with a delicate holder can damage the instrument's hinge or jaws. Maintenance and Longevity of Surgical Tools Proper care extends the life of surgical instruments and ensures they function correctly during critical moments. Regular inspection of the hinge and locking mechanism prevents unexpected failures in the operating room. Cleaning processes must be thorough to remove all biological debris, followed by appropriate lubrication of moving parts before sterilization. A well-maintained needle holder should open and close smoothly, and the jaws should align perfectly without any gaps when locked. The Connection Between Quality Tools and Patient Outcomes The ultimate goal of any surgical intervention is the well-being of the patient. Using inferior or worn-out instruments can lead to complications such as increased operative time, tissue trauma, or compromised suture integrity.
